YouWave 4 features
TaskDisplay 3 features
  • User-Friendly Interface
    YouWave provides an intuitive and easy-to-navigate user interface, making it accessible for users with varying levels of technical expertise.
  • Supports Android Apps
    YouWave enables users to run Android applications on their PCs, offering a platform for app development and testing without needing a physical device.
  • Lightweight
    The software is generally less resource-intensive compared to some other Android emulators, which can be advantageous for users with limited system resources.
  • Offline Installer
    YouWave provides a simple offline installation process, allowing users to set up the emulator without needing an active internet connection.

Possible disadvantages

  • Outdated Android Version
    YouWave runs an older version of Android (typically 4.0.4 Ice Cream Sandwich), limiting compatibility with newer applications.
  • Lack of Advanced Features
    Compared to other emulators, YouWave lacks advanced features such as the ability to simulate GPS location or multi-touch support.
  • Paid Software
    While there is a free trial available, the full version of YouWave requires a purchase, which may not be ideal for users seeking completely free solutions.
  • Performance Issues
    Some users experience performance issues, such as lag and crashes, especially when running resource-heavy applications.
